    Pseudolaric Acid B is an orally active diterpene acid. Pseudolaric Acid B has anti-fungal, anti-fertility, anti-angiogenesis and anticancer activity, and can induce tumor cell apoptosis and autophagy. In addition, Pseudolaric Acid B can inhibit the secretion of hepatitis B virus (HBV) and has immunosuppressive effect, selectively inhibiting the proliferation of T lymphocytes and the production of IL-2.

    PROTAC HIF-1α degrader-1 (compound V2) is a potent hypoxia-inducible factor-1α (HIF-1α) PROTAC degrader with an IC50 value of 7.54 µM. PROTAC HIF-1α degrader-1 shows anti-proliferative activity. PROTAC HIF-1α degrader-1 decreases the HIF-1α protein expression. PROTAC HIF-1α degrader-1 induces apoptosis.     NEO-811 is a selective and orally active ARNT (HIF-1β) molecular glue degrader. NEO-811 is mediated by CRL4-CRBN E3 ligase for ARNT degradation. NEO-811 can be used for the study of clear cell renal cell carcinoma (ccRCC).

    PROTAC HIF-1α degrader-2 is a highly efficient and selective PROTAC degrader targeting HIF-1α. PROTAC HIF-1α degrader-2 promotes HIF-1α degradation via the ubiquitin-proteasome pathway by facilitating the formation of a HIF-1α/VHL ternary complex. PROTAC HIF-1α degrader-2 inhibits HeLa cell proliferation, migration, and colony formation, and induces apoptosis. PROTAC HIF-1α degrader-2 reduces p-MEK and p-AKT expression in the MAPK and PI3K/AKT pathways. PROTAC HIF-1α degrader-2 can be used for the study of cervical cancer.
